Thu Sep 5 13:18:25 1996 Thomas Bushnell, n/BSG <thomas@gnu.ai.mit.edu> * sysdeps/mach/hurd/i386/init-first.c (__libc_argc, __libc_argv): New variables. (init1): Initialize them. * hurd/hurdinit.c (_hurd_setproc): Now that happens to be available, pass __libc_argv in call to __proc_set_arg_locations. * gmon/gmon.c (write_hist): Call __profile_frequency instead of hertz. (hertz): Delete function. * gmon/Makefile (routines): Add `prof-freq'. * sysdeps/generic/prof-freq.c: New file. * sysdeps/mach/hurd/prof-freq.c: New (stubby) file. * sysdeps/mach/hurd/profil.c (profile_tick): New variable. (update_waiter): Store frequency in profile_tick. (__profile_frequency): New function. * sysdeps/mach/hurd/sendto.c (sendto): Use prototype definition syntax. * Rules (generated): Restore reference to $(generated). * mach/Machrules (mig.uh, mig.__h): Don't include $(user-MIGFLAGS) here. * malloc/free.c (free): __lib_malloc_lock -> __libc_malloc_lock. * malloc/free.c: Provide extern decl of __libc_malloc_lock. * malloc/realloc.c: Likewise. * malloc/malloc-find.c: Likewise. * malloc/malloc-size.c: Likewise. * malloc/malloc-walk.c: Likewise. * malloc/memalign.c: Likewise. * mach/Machrules (mig.uh, mig.__h): Include $(user-MIGFLAGS) and
